On Tue, Apr 13, 2004 at 08:46:27PM -0400, Angelo Bertolli wrote:
> Then... aside from setting the sticky bit, you essentially have write 
> access to any file in a directory you have write access to?  I mean 
> unlinking and creating a new file with the same name is essentiall the 
> same thing as changing the file, right?

So long as there is only one link to the file in the filesystem.  If there
are more links to the file, you can only change the link(s) from
directories that you can write.
